I have Cox Cable internet 5mb down, 1.5MB up, I normally get the speed burst for 20 to 30 seconds of 1.2MB per second actual download speed, and 256kb per second upload.
But a few days ago I noticed i was bursting sometimes as high as 3mb a second, and right now i am downloading 3dmark06 at 1.33MB a second which is about twice what I used to get. Just finish 580mb in 7min 20 seconds Very nice speed boost, I hope it stays this fast!!! still paying $41.95 a month, no tax or fees of any kind. |

Yes and yesterday I received an email stating that my "Preferred" connection speed was going from 5mb /2mb to 10mb/2mb (powerboost 12.5mb/2.5mb).
They also have their "Premier", which went from 15mb/2mb to 20mb/3mb (25/3.5 w/powerboost) I think FiOS is starting to scare them, so they keep bumping up the speeds to keep people from switching. I did a speed test yesterday and I was getting 22mb/2.5mb for my "preferred" connection. Actual d/l speeds are pretty much spot on for 10mb/2mb though.
